Online gaming and advertising group Media Corporation says that trading was strong in the three months to December 2010.

Revenues grew from £4.6m to £5.6m in the first quarter of the new financial year. Gambling business Purple Lounge contributed £500,000 of the improvement. 

The Eyeconomy online advertising business increased its revenues by one-third to £1.6m.

Negotiations for the sale of the Gambling.com portal are continuing. The sale should be completed by the end of March. 

The figures for the year to September 2010 are likely to be published in March.

At 2.9p a share, down 0.12p, Media Corp is valued at £9.82m.
